A simple web page that shows how Zühlke employees use GitHub Copilot:
- Fetches data from GitHub API.
- Displays different metrics as charts.
- Open
webpage/index.html
in your browser. - When no credentials have been set: Click "Set Credentials", enter GitHub organization and API key.
- When credentials have already been set: Click "Refresh".
- The refresh button reloads all GitHub data and updates the dashboard.
Note: This is a client-side tool; keep your API key secure.
- GitHub Copilot usage is granted via this GitHub organization: https://github.com/zuhlkeengineering
- Therefor the API key must be created for this organization.
- An Owner of the organization has to create the API key in his/her account settings:
- Open https://github.com/settings/personal-access-tokens/new
- Set "Token name" and "Description" however you like
- Set the "Resource owner" to "zuhlkeengineering"
- Set "Expiration" according to your security policy
- "Add permissions" -> "GitHub Copilot Business" -> "Read-only"
- "Generate token"
- Copy the token and store it somewhere safe (Bitwarden)
